Family-oriented suburbs
Thick with trees and tidy lawns, the suburban neighborhood of Kendale evokes a sense of seclusion—exactly its goal, according to many locals. “It’s a calm area,” says Chris Cooley, a Realtor with Red 1 Realty. “It’s family-oriented, so during the day, there’s not a lot of people around with parents working and the kids at school.” Younger families especially have come to Kendale since the 1950s, taking advantage of lower real estate prices than comparable neighborhoods like Knolls-Thomas and Clintonville.
Kendale is a small neighborhood situated about eight miles north of downtown Columbus.
Interstate 315 connects Kendale with the Ohio State University and downtown Columbus.

Lower prices than similar suburbs
Tree-shaded culs-de-sac give the houses a sense of privacy. Midcentury homes occupy quarter-acre lots, often with attached two-car garages. With a median price of $450,000, houses in the area are less expensive than comparable homes in the nearby towns of Dublin or Upper Arlington. “People like being close to those areas, but housing is more affordable in Kendale,” Cooley says. Prices typically start in the low $300,000s for single-story, ranch-style houses. Prices for two-story, split-levels begin in the mid-$400,000s and peak in the mid-$500,000s with the addition of amenities like pools or covered patios.

Centennial High rivalries and team spirit
Students start at Winterset Elementary School, which has a C-plus rating from Niche. From there, they attend Ridgeview Middle School, with a C-minus. Older children enroll at Centennial High School, with a B from Niche, which lists the school as one of the top 100 college preparatory schools in Ohio. Centennial and Whetstone High School are separated by the Olentangy River, creating one of the area’s biggest sports rivalries known locally as “the Battle for the Olentangy.”

Authentic Indian food at Dosa Corner
Dosa Corner is a family-owned, South Indian restaurant that offers dine-in or carryout on classics like potato curry, chana masala and biryani. The menu is fully vegetarian, so visitors shouldn’t expect to find butter chicken as an option. Open since 1978, Iacono’s is definitely not vegetarian, and specializes in handcrafted pizzas like the old world pepperoni and the bbq chicken. Kenny Centre and nearby Kenny Road are the homes of several shopping options, including fast food and the Tensuke Market, a Japanese grocery store.

Homeruns at Anheuser-Busch Sports Park
With its 149 acres, Whetstone Park has long stretches of uninterrupted woodland. This area also serves as an entry point for the 14-mile Olentangy Trail, which goes as far south as downtown Columbus. Competitors of every skill level take advantage of their many athletic courts. Anheuser-Busch Sports Park's courts include eight baseball diamonds, and the Bill McDonald Athletic Complex has indoor athletic facilities and courts available to rent.

Buy local art at the Labor Day Arts Festival
Neighboring Upper Arlington is the home of the Labor Day Arts Festival, which draws over 15,000 people annually for a day of food, local art exhibitions and hands-on activities. Sunny 95 Park hosts an annual Spring Fling festival in May, which includes live music, games and Touch A Truck, an opportunity for kids to get hands-on experience with fire trucks, construction equipment and police cruisers.

Easy access to the beltway
With the Olentangy River just to the east and The Ohio State University campus to the south, Kendale is convenient to Route 315, which leads to downtown Columbus and the Interstate 270 Beltway. A lack of sidewalks makes the neighborhood less walkable than most, but the Central Ohio Transit Authority has a regular bus service with several stops on Kenny Road.

On average, homes in Kendale, Columbus sell after 47 days on the market compared to the national average of 52 days. The median sale price for homes in Kendale, Columbus over the last 12 months is $404,400, down 7%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
